Koh Oknha Tei: Countryside and Local Life

Once on Silk Island, the tour visits Koh Oknha Tei, a farming village where you’ll see vibrant rice paddies and orchards. Here, you’ll also observe local market activities, including tofu skin production and a Buddhist temple. Silk Weaving: A Cultural Treasure

The visit to the Silk Island Community Center is often praised for its authenticity. Villagers demonstrate traditional silk weaving techniques, passing down this craft through generations. It’s a rare opportunity to see artisans at work and learn about Cambodia’s silk heritage firsthand—something many travelers find inspiring.
